Position Summary Alarm Service Technicians troubleshoot, repair, perform preventative maintenance (and occasionally install alarm systems). Alarm Inspectors are responsible for conducting routine inspections, testing, service, and preventative maintenance on alarm product lines as well as similar competitive manufacturers' product lines. Essential Functions Work with low-voltage wiring and associated devices for the operation of alarm, security and access control equipment. Follow and maintain a highly structured inspection schedule. Input, retrieve and archive inspection documents via laptop computer. Make minor repairs and programming changes to systems being inspected. Provide technical training to less senior inspectors and trainees. Complete assigned inspections on time. Perform other duties as assigned. Desired Qualification Requirements Bilingual (English & Spanish) Strongly preferred High School Diploma or equivalent required. Valid Driver's License. Ability to pass drug screen and reference check. Experience with hand tools and multi-meter usage.
NICET II
certification preferred, NICET I required. 2+ years of documented service experience in fire alarm service/inspection. Demonstrates an aptitude for troubleshooting systems and performing necessary repairs. Ability to follow verbal and written instructions. Ability to work flexible hours including weekends to meet customer requirements. Ability to adhere to, implement, and follow safety guidelines and procedures at all times. Demonstrate a high level of customer service. Ability to work well with others. Self-starter that can work with little to no supervision. Strong organizational skills, a positive attitude, and an ability to learn quickly. Physical Requirements You must be able to lift a dead weight of at least 50 pounds and stand on your feet for several hours at a time. You must also be able to bend, stretch, crouch, and lift as required by the job, be able to respond quickly to sounds, move safely over uneven terrain or in confined spaces, see and respond to dangerous situations, safely climb ladders while carrying tools/items, work in extreme weather, and properly wear personal protective gear.
